Spike: P0 plugin catalog
Status: done
Question
What may the agent ever install?
Done when
- ~40 slugs written
wp plugin install <url>is forbidden even before an install playbook exists
Result
The agent may install only from the catalog table below, and only from wordpress.org via slug (wp plugin install <slug>). That playbook does not exist in the MVP. The rule still ships in Sprint 3 tool schemas so a heading-change agent cannot install anything.
Forbidden (now and in v1)
wp plugin install <url>wp plugin installwith a local zip or any path- Premium / marketplace URLs (Elementor Pro zip, Woo market, GitHub)
- Any slug not in the catalog
- Re-install of a detect-only plugin (table below)
Fail closed. Unknown slug → refuse and say so in chat. Do not search wordpress.org ad hoc.
Reputation, zip SHA, and egress-watch on first activate are Sprint 9. This note is only the allowlist.
Paid services behind a free slug (WooPayments, Site Kit) still hit the no-surprise gate at deploy.

Detect-only — never install
These break REST, deploys, or hosts. Site-info reports them. The agent does not install them.

Decision
- Context: wordpress.org is not a reviewed-safe catalog. Preview cannot see a plugin phoning home. MVP has no install playbook, but the agent still needs a hard wall.
- Options: open wordpress.org search vs a written allowlist vs delay any wall until Sprint 9.
- Chosen: 40-slug allowlist now; no URL/zip; detect-only list for security/cache suites; no install tool in MVP.
- Rejected: open search (R2). Installing Wordfence/Jetpack/cache suites (they break the product or the site).
